> Since you appear to generate the patches with git, you can use "git diff
> --check [...]" for some basic whitespace checks (additions of trailing
> space, additions of space before tab). For more extensive checks, try
> "git diff [...] | scripts/checkpatch.pl -". Check this before you
> commit. If you committed already, "git commit --amend [-a] [...]" lets
> you alter the very last commit of course.
